Translation

EN

Allah turned with favour to the Prophet, the Muhajirs, and the Ansar,- who followed him in a time of distress, after that the hearts of a part of them had nearly swerved (from duty); but He turned to them (also): for He is unto them Most Kind, Most Merciful.

A. Yusuf Alipublic-domain

In His mercy God has turned to the Prophet, and the emigrants and helpers who followed him in the hour of adversity when some hearts almost wavered: He has turned to them; He is most kind and merciful to them.

M.A.S. Abdel Haleemall-rights-reserved

Allah hath turned in mercy to the Prophet, and to the Muhajirin and the Ansar who followed him in the hour of hardship. After the hearts of a party of them had almost swerved aside, then turned He unto them in mercy. Lo! He is Full of Pity, Merciful for them.

M. Pickthallpublic-domain

Allāh has already forgiven the Prophet and the Muhājireen and the Anṣār who followed him in the hour of difficulty after the hearts of a party of them had almost inclined [to doubt], and then He forgave them. Indeed, He was to them Kind and Merciful.

لقد وفَّق الله نبيه محمدا صلى الله عليه وسلم إلى الإنابة إليه وطاعته، وتاب الله على المهاجرين الذين هجروا ديارهم وعشيرتهم إلى دار الإسلام، وتاب على أنصار رسول الله صلى الله عليه وسلم الذين خرجوا معه لقتال الأعداء في غزوة (تبوك) في حرٍّ شديد، وضيق من الزاد والظَّهْر، لقد تاب الله عليهم من بعد ما كاد يَميل قلوب بعضهم عن الحق، فيميلون إلى الدَّعة والسكون، لكن الله ثبتهم وقوَّاهم وتاب عليهم، إنه بهم رؤوف رحيم. ومن رحمته بهم أنْ مَنَّ عليهم بالتوبة، وقَبِلَها منهم، وثبَّتهم عليها.
